Get in Touch with Us

We're here to help you with your questions about our products, and we've made it easy and convenient for you to reach us.

Tel.: +86 755 8233 2214 Ext. 835/840

Fax: +86 755 8233 2036


Add.: No. 6518, Tingfeng Expressway, Fengjing Town, Jinshan District, Shanghai, China.